    Question Windows protection error on startup

    I have a K-6 2 350 and every so often on startup, I get an error message that says windows protection error, you must restart your computer. Sometimes it says IOS initialization failed (or something like that). When I first got the chip, someone told me to DL a patch from Microsoft. I just wiped my HDD and forgot about the patch. I can't find it now. Can anyone help?

    Can anyone help me.
    I installed a amd k6 II -450 and I almost always get the windows protection error message when starting windows. I have windows 95(not osr2).Tried the amdk6upd.exe patch but it won't work because it says its not for my version. Everything I have read about it says only happens with osr2. Can anyone please help me.

  6. #6
    year2000
    Guest

    Post

    ET
    The 1st version of win95 doesn't have alot of support for the newer processors, boards, agp, usb etc. Most likely 95 is having a problem with the motherboard's chipset. What motherboard is with your k62 450?
    Also make sure the voltage for your processor is set at 2.4 volts and not 2.2.
    There are alot more errors with that old an operating system. Suggest you get win98 (1st or 2nd edition) and try that out.
